We’re seeing a lot of changes at Disney World recently!

We’ve seen mask policies change, with masks now optional in most areas for vaccinated guests. And as social distancing is decreased around the parks and resorts, Disney has announced plans to bring back fireworks soon. But today, we spotted a difference in the health and safety information on the Disney World website!
On the “Know Before You Go” page of the Disney World website, there used to be a section dedicated to physical distancing. Today, that section has been removed entirely.

We knew that physical distancing was being decreased in the parks, and over the past few days, we’ve seen ground markers disappearing from Disney World.

Today, we started to see policies change with boarding transportation — we were grouped with several other parties on the monorail this morning. Rides are also getting rid of plexiglass dividers and seating guests close together again.
